Grand Isle
Published in 1899, The Awakening follows Edna Pontellier during a summer vacation at Grand Isle, a resort island off the Louisiana coast. Among the relaxed Creole society, Edna begins to feel stirrings of independence she has never known — even learning to swim for the first time.

Kate Chopin sets the awakening within Creole society, where sensuality is openly acknowledged in conversation and daily life but women's actual freedom remains rigidly constrained.
